APC National Secretary, Dr. Ajibola Basiru, Celebrates Osun APC Chairman Sooko Lawal at 60

The National Secretary of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Dr. Ajibola Basiru, has extended warm felicitations to the Osun State Chairman of the party, Sooko Tajudeen Olaniyi Lawal, on the occasion of his 60th birthday.

In a goodwill message on Thursday, Dr. Basiru described Sooko Lawal as a visionary leader whose unwavering commitment and exceptional leadership qualities have continued to stabilize and reposition the APC in Osun State.

“I rejoice with you on this special occasion, Mr Chairman. Your leadership qualities have held the party together, while your magic wand has given Osun APC the strength it needs to weather the political storm in the state,” Dr. Basiru stated.

He further praised Lawal’s simplicity, gentle disposition, and sociability, noting that these traits have endeared him to party members and leaders alike.

According to him, Lawal’s dedication to the party has not gone unnoticed at the federal level, as evidenced by his appointment as Chairman of the Governing Board of the Federal College of Agriculture, Ibadan.

“I pray Allaah to bless your new age and endow you with more wisdom to be able to paddle the canoe of our party to a safer harbour,” he added.

Sooko Lawal, a native of Ile-Ife, was a former Commissioner for Home Affairs and Tourism in Osun State. He assumed office as Acting Chairman of the APC in the state following the installation of Prince Gboyega Famodun as the Owa of Igbajo. He was later confirmed as substantive chairman in July 2023 after a commendable performance during his time in acting capacity.

An alumnus of Obafemi Awolowo University, Ile-Ife, Lawal holds degrees in Economics and Public Administration. He has also served as the Executive Secretary of Ife East Local Government.

Party faithful across the state have continued to send in their best wishes, describing him as a stabilizing force in the Osun APC and a leader whose experience and dedication continue to inspire.
